Symons agrees to contract extension with Mustangs
DALLAS (SMU) – SMU Defensive Coordinator Scott Symons has signed a contract extension to remain on the Hilltop, Head Coach Rhett Lashlee announced Thursday.
A semifinalist for the prestigious Broyles Award which honors college football's top assistant coach, Symons was a highly sought-after candidate for other openings, but will remain at SMU.
In his third season on the Hilltop, Symons and his staff have done incredible work on the defensive side of the ball. SMU has built on a dominant championship defense and his efforts helped SMU claim a College Football Playoff berth.
In SMU's first season in the ACC, his defense helped SMU to an 8-0 regular-season record and ranked among the nation's best. SMU finished the regular season at 11-1, ranking in the top 25 in the FBS in rushing defense (fourth), defensive touchdowns (fifth), team sacks (11th), third down conversion percentage defense (11th), team tackles for loss (12th), passes intercepted (13th), red zone defense (16th), scoring defense (19th), turnovers gained (23rd) and fourth down conversion percentage defense (23rd).
